ペタるリンクを付けるGreasemonkeyを更新しました
少し前に書いたアメーバの『ペタ』を手軽に付けられるGreasemonkeyをアメーバの仕様変更に対応して公開しました。意外に需要のあるスクリプトだったようなので、新しいポストで報告しておきます。
と言うわけで、かなり簡潔ですが今年最後のポストでした。
皆さん良いお年を!
少し前に書いたアメーバの『ペタ』を手軽に付けられるGreasemonkeyをアメーバの仕様変更に対応して公開しました。意外に需要のあるスクリプトだったようなので、新しいポストで報告しておきます。
と言うわけで、かなり簡潔ですが今年最後のポストでした。
皆さん良いお年を!
jQueryの開発リポジトリに入っているファイルは、開発用のためモジュール毎に分割されています。
コードを追う時は良いですが、開発中のjQueryが使いたい!と言う時に、これらを全て読み込むのはちょっと面倒なので、ビルドして一つのファイルにしてみたいと思います。
今回は、Windowsの場合とMacの場合二つの方法を紹介します。
ある朝僕は、以下の用件を満たすカレンダープラグインを探していました。
小一時間色々なプラグインを見ましたが、中々しっくり来るモノが無く、「これは探すより作った方が早そうかなぁ」と思ったので作ってみました。
様々な誘惑に負けてMacBook Proを購入したのでセットアップの内容をメモ。
Macを触るのは今回が初めてと言うことで、Macbook (with Snow Leopard) 買った後にやったことまとめ - IT戦記を大いに参考にしつつ、部分的に自分なりの設定にしてみました。
※とりあえず、トラックパッドは良い仕事してますね。
Dropboxを使い出してから自分用メモをブログに書くことが少なくなった気がするので、ちょっと古いですがVMware Toolsで快適な環境を作るメモ。
VMware Toolsを導入すると、「ファイルを開いたままVMware(samba)を終了してしまい、Explorerが固まってうわっふじこ」が無くなります。
その他、VMwareを起動していなくてもファイルを閲覧・編集出来たり、CGIモードじゃなくてもパーミッションの設定を(常に書き込み権限が与えられるため)スキップ出来たり、ホストOSと時刻を同期出来たり、とにかく便利になるのでオススメです。
某勉強会のグループチャットにて、『JavaScriptでXMLを取得、パースして適当に表示しなさい』と言う宿題が出た時、ちょっと欲しいなぁと思ったので勉強がてら作ってみました。
一応date関数に対応する全てのフォーマット文字列が使えますが、タイムゾーン周りを正確に実装するのは実質不可能なので、eは「Asia/Tokyo」、Tは「JST」固定になっています。
その他、副産物で日付周りのメソッドも色々生えてるので、良かったら使ってみて下さい。
レンタルサーバーではmod_expiresが使えない場合が多いので、PHPとmod_rewriteで頑張って追加してみよう的な感じです。
ただ、以下で示す方法は、画像などの静的ファイルにExpiresヘッダを追加するため、ファイル数分のPHPが動くのでサーバーに大きな負荷をかけてしまいます。
上記理由により、アクセスが多いサイトでは、使用しない方が無難かも知れません。
もの凄く需要が無さそうですが書いたので公開。
アメーバにはペタと言うよく分からない機能が付いていて、ペタが付けられたらペタ返しをするのが慣わしのようですが、通常のプロセスでペタ返しを行うと3クリックもしなければなりません。
そんな特殊な文化に慣れていない身としては、この3クリックは非常に煩わしいかったので、ペタ帳(ペタの履歴)画面から直接ペタを付けられるGreasemonkeyスクリプトを書いてみました。
WordPressに限った話では無いですが、移行用のエクスポートファイルは移行先のツールに合わせたフォーマットの方が良いんじゃないかと言うお話。
ブログツールによっては、各種ブログのエクスポートフォーマットに合わせたインポート機能がついていたりしますが、結局は他所様の作ったツールなので対応が微妙だったりしますよね。
その点、今回提案する方法なら、割とスムーズにインポート出来るんじゃないかなと思います。
※今回はMTからの移行を例に説明していますが、他のブログサービスやブログツールでも、なんらかの方法で書き出しが可能ならばいけると思います。
はてなダイアリーでおなじみのはてな記法ですが、慣れるとさくさく記事が書けて良いので、是非WordPressでも使いたいと思い、HatenaSyntax - openpearを利用して作ってみました。
手軽に導入出来るので、はてな記法が大好きなWordPressユーザーは是非使ってみて下さい。